4/11/2024 - jlhkiss wrote: 90 points

Paired with salmon cake and mixed salad. Dark crimson-purple color with a violet hue. Muted nose brings red lavender, potpourri, and cherry menthol. The palate is medium, round, and jammy, bringing a nice core of dark fruit interlaced with high-toned cherry and raspberry notes, which leads into a tannic finish of cloves and black tea. This has a good frame and thick tannins which bodes well for further aging. However, right now this doesn't taste 'fresh' to me as the jammy fruit is distracting and bogs the palate down. I also detect some heat on the tail from higher alcohol (14.5%). Drink 2026-2034. Technical score: 90. Enjoyment score: 90.

1/30/2024 - La Bodega Baru Likes this wine: 92 points

La Digoine is a meticulously crafted single-vineyard Pinot Noir, birthed from the 1.8 hectares of terroir where aged vines, between 35 and 45 years old, sink their roots into a blend of clay and limestone. During harvest, a rigorous selection process ensures that only the best fruit is chosen, with around two-thirds of the grapes traditionally fermented as whole clusters. Post-fermentation, the wine matures in barrels over a period ranging from 10 to 12 months before it finds its way to the bottle.

In the glass the La Digoine 2020 shines in a surprisingly intense ruby red color captivating the eye. On the palate a harmonious mingling of both red and dark cherries is adorned with the rustic notes of dried herbs and an undercurrent of spices. Upon tasting, the palate is graced with a spectrum of vibrant fruit aromas. The structure is defined by tannins that are both ripe and assertive, contributing to the wine’s balance, yet they subtly hint at the warmth of the vintage that they cannot entirely mask. La Digoine stands out as a splendid introduction to the complexities of Burgundy wines, offering an accessible indulgence for both novices and seasoned aficionados of the region, at a price point that is as alluring as the wine itself.

1/6/2023 - SB5784 Likes this wine: 92 points

Tasted via Corivan alongside the Les Clous front the same year. A rich, ruby red color. Glowing and very pure. Some subtle aging on the edges. The nose is very open and flamboyant; perfumed. Lots of fresh red berry fruit, some spiced cherry, and kirsch like notes as well. High toned floral notes and lifted. On the palate, this is medium bodied, with a soft and silky texture but gains some roughness on the midpalate and finish. The fruit is consistent with the nose. Quite balanced but with still quite significant tannins (but they are ripe and integrated even now). My only real criticism would be some dryness on the back of the palate and a slight bitter taste on the otherwise long and enjoyable finish. This is really impressive and enjoyable right now.
